Floor-to-Ceiling Windows

If you have a gorgeous view to showcase, floor-to-ceiling windows are a great choice. These massive glass panels blur the lines between indoors and outdoors, letting in floods of light and a feeling of infinite space. They also provide unobstructed views, which can be especially pleasing in the vicinity of an imposing mountain or a picturesque lake.

The windows can be set up to suit the architectural style of your home. For a more traditional style, consider wood windows with historic detailing and architect-inspired hardware. If you live in an modern home with simple lines and elegant simplicity, think about the custom-made Pixel windows. They have an enlarged mullion by 33 and give them the look of ceiling-to-floor windows in an elegant and minimalist style.

To create a more diverse appearance, you could combine non-operable and operable windows to make your window wall. For instance, you can make use of a large picture window with smaller casement windows that are in the shape of an L or you can combine windows that are double-hung or single-hung to create a window wall with different openings and heights. Geometric pairing is another well-known design that combines larger windows with smaller windows in a staggered, brick-like arrangement.

A window wall can be a stunning and unique addition to your home. However, due to the amount of construction involved in removing walls and installing new ones, it's more expensive than simply replacing a regular window. It's also necessary to budget additional expenses for rerouting electrical wiring as well as pipes. You should speak with an agent in your area to determine how this project will affect the value of your home when you decide to sell it.

Easy-to-Clean Windows

Just like carpets and lawn furniture, appliances and, windows require regular cleaning to remain in good condition. Keeping your windows clean is not only easy and cost-effective but can also help safeguard your investment by catching wood rot, mildew and other issues early on. Plus, it makes your home look beautiful!

You must first get rid of any debris and dust from the frames or sills with the help of a vacuum cleaner or duster before you begin cleaning your windows. If you have blinds or screens, leewhan.com it is also important to clean them. Clean them and scrub them with the use of a soapy water solution or wash them with plain water and a little of vinegar Then rinse and allow them to dry thoroughly.

Apply the solution you have chosen for cleaning whether it's soapy or non-abrasive water, or diluted vinegar, onto your lint-free microfiber cloth. Avoid using any solvents, cleaners or other chemicals on the vinyl, fiberglass or wood frames as they may discolor them.

Start at the top of your windows and work your way down. After you've cleaned the entire pane with the solution, use a microfiber cloth to get rid of any remaining residue.

Pro Tip: For stubborn dirt and grime add a few tablespoons of vinegar to your cleaning solution to act as a degreaser. The acidity in vinegar will dissolve oily substances and give you an even, clean finish. Dishwasher detergent, which is readily available in many households and contains the powerful anti-greasing agent, sodium laurylsulfate is another common ingredient that can be used to clean windows. It also assists in making those pesky greasy fingerprints and streaks disappear.

Energy-Efficient Windows

As energy consumption continues to rise around the world, homeowners are becoming aware of the impact that their cooling and heating systems can impact their utility bills. As a result, they're turning to window technologies that can help reduce the cost and create a more comfortable living environment without breaking the bank.

Smart design gives superior www.repairmywindowsanddoors.Co.Uk insulation properties in energy efficient windows. They block solar energy and regulate the retention of heat according to the climate. In turn, this reduces the need for extreme heating or cooling and significantly reduces energy consumption.

Windows that are energy efficient are not just very insulating, they also feature low maintenance coatings that ward off dust, dirt and debris, reducing the need to clean them often. They also feature enhanced frame and sealing designs that stop drafts and leaks to increase efficiency.

Lastly windows that are energy efficient usually have multiple panes of glass for additional insulation. They can be double or triple-glazed with spacers between each pane. This allows you to keep the cool air inside your home and the heat outside during the summer, and vice versa. There are many kinds of gas fills that can be placed between the panes to enhance insulation properties. Krypton and argon are popular choices.

In addition to reducing energy consumption windows that are energy efficient can aid in blocking out noise pollution. The tight seals of windows and frames that are energy efficient prevent gaps or leaks which allow outside noise into the home. This is particularly beneficial for people who live near busy roads and construction sites that are ongoing or noisy neighbors.

Security Windows

Homeowners and renters can make their windows secure by following a few easy guidelines. They can put up security bars or install new windows with double glazing and night locks built-in, which will make it more difficult to break into windows. New windows are more expensive than repairing or replacing existing windows, but they do aid in reducing energy costs and increase security, too.

Window shutters or window guards also deter criminals from breaking into a window. Grilles, which are decorative metalwork covering windows and preventing access, can also enhance aesthetic appeal. Shutters are fitted into windows and cannot be removed or removed from the frame. A hinged wedge lock that grows larger and stronger when it's pushed up can shield casement windows, while chain locks can stop a sliding window from being opened beyond a certain point. These solutions offer the security of bars, but without the prison feel. They can also be easily removed to allow for egress points in the event of a fire or other emergency.
